.ColdQuest_container__gu1AO{display:flex;justify-content:center;align-items:center;width:100vw;height:100vh;height:100svh}.desktop .ColdQuest_container__gu1AO{padding:16px 100px}.mobile .ColdQuest_container__gu1AO,.webview .ColdQuest_container__gu1AO{padding:0}.ColdQuest_inner__V6FNY{position:relative;display:flex;flex-direction:column;width:100%;height:100%;overflow:hidden;border-radius:var(--border-radius-l);max-width:590px;max-height:846px;padding-top:max(var(--bm-safe-area-top),16px);padding-bottom:max(var(--bm-safe-area-bottom),12px);box-shadow:0 10px 40px 0 rgba(0,0,0,.2)}.mobile .ColdQuest_inner__V6FNY,.webview .ColdQuest_inner__V6FNY{box-shadow:none;max-width:none;max-height:none;border-radius:0}.ColdQuestError_container__JlO_D.ColdQuestError_container__JlO_D{height:100%;position:relative}.ColdQuestError_button__MEyzT{margin-top:16px}.ColdQuestError_closeButton__cZq5P{position:absolute;top:max(var(--bm-safe-area-top),16px);right:16px;display:flex;align-items:center;justify-content:center;width:32px;height:32px;border-radius:32px;border:none;cursor:pointer;padding:0;background:var(--actions-button-bg);color:var(--actions-primary)}.ColdQuestError_closeButton__cZq5P path{fill:currentColor}.error-block_container__eAGPF{height:calc(100vh - 200px);display:flex}.error-block_content__E_T7r{width:100%;max-width:460px;margin:auto;padding:0 16px;display:flex;align-items:center;flex-direction:column}.error-block_image__pd_1M{width:460px}.error-block_title__UJpxz{margin:12px 0 0;text-align:center;color:var(--text-primary)}.error-block_image__pd_1M+.error-block_title__UJpxz{margin-top:24px}.error-block_text__hYd8I[class]{color:var(--text-secondary);margin-top:8px;text-align:center}.mobile .error-block_content__E_T7r{height:100vh;margin-top:0;display:flex;align-items:center;flex-direction:column;justify-content:center}.mobile .error-block_title__UJpxz{font-size:32px;font-style:normal;font-weight:600;line-height:38px}.mobile .error-block_text__hYd8I{font-size:17px;font-style:normal;font-weight:400;line-height:120%}@media (max-width:374px){.error-block_image__pd_1M{display:none}}.ColdQuestProgress_container__hhwqv{display:flex;align-items:center;justify-content:center;padding:16px;background:var(--background-base,#fff);position:relative}.ColdQuestProgress_steps__dEQ_r{display:flex;gap:4px;width:98px}.ColdQuestProgress_step__J3nnQ{height:3px;flex:1 1;background:var(--actions-button-bg);transition:background-color .3s ease}.ColdQuestProgress_stepActive__vnohe{height:3px;flex:1 1;background:var(--icons-common);transition:background-color .3s ease}.ColdQuestProgress_closeButton__BzczR{position:absolute;right:16px;display:flex;align-items:center;justify-content:center;width:32px;height:32px;border-radius:32px;border:none;cursor:pointer;padding:0;background:var(--actions-button-bg);color:var(--actions-primary)}.ColdQuestProgress_closeButton__BzczR path{fill:currentColor}.ColdQuestProgress_closeButton__BzczR:active{transform:scale(.95)}.ColdQuestHeader_header__kqUy5{display:flex;flex-direction:column;align-items:center;gap:4px;padding:8px 16px 0;text-align:center;width:100%}.ColdQuestHeader_title__nG1fg{color:var(--text-primary)}.ColdQuestHeader_subtitle__TAHG7{color:var(--text-secondary);letter-spacing:.32px}@keyframes ColdQuestLoader_pulse__FsBBq{0%{opacity:1}50%{opacity:.8}to{opacity:1}}.ColdQuestLoader_container__z9dGA{display:flex;flex:1 1;flex-direction:column;width:100%;min-height:0}.ColdQuestLoader_header__p2ouN{display:flex;flex-direction:column;gap:12px;padding:0 16px}.ColdQuestLoader_bookCover__pR273,.ColdQuestLoader_bookHeart__CiXTD,.ColdQuestLoader_button__FWEmp,.ColdQuestLoader_genreIcon__j_KL0,.ColdQuestLoader_genreItem__GMfw7,.ColdQuestLoader_genreLabel__DbIeg,.ColdQuestLoader_progressText__8qYQ_,.ColdQuestLoader_subtitle__R75ux,.ColdQuestLoader_title__S0VFM{background-color:var(--background-loader);animation:ColdQuestLoader_pulse__FsBBq 1.5s ease-in-out infinite}.ColdQuestLoader_title__S0VFM{width:260px;height:32px;border-radius:8px}.ColdQuestLoader_subtitle__R75ux{width:220px;height:18px;border-radius:6px}.ColdQuestLoader_main__RGX1K{flex:1 1;min-height:0;padding:24px 16px 16px;overflow:hidden}.ColdQuestLoader_genreGrid__tipul{padding:8px 16px;display:grid;grid-gap:10px;gap:10px;height:100%;grid-template-rows:repeat(auto-fill,162px);grid-auto-flow:column;grid-auto-columns:162px;place-content:center flex-start;overflow-x:hidden;overflow-y:hidden}.ColdQuestLoader_genreItem__GMfw7{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:6px;height:162px;border-radius:20px}.ColdQuestLoader_genreIcon__j_KL0{width:82px;height:82px;border-radius:50%}.ColdQuestLoader_genreLabel__DbIeg{width:72px;height:16px;border-radius:6px}.ColdQuestLoader_bookScrollWrap__6F0Zg{width:100%;height:100%;overflow:hidden;padding:8px 16px;display:flex;align-items:center}.ColdQuestLoader_bookRows__SVpbk{display:grid;grid-template-rows:repeat(auto-fill,calc(152px + 14px));grid-auto-flow:column;grid-auto-columns:107px;align-content:center;grid-gap:10px 8px;gap:10px 8px;height:100%;width:-moz-max-content;width:max-content}.ColdQuestLoader_bookCover__pR273{width:107px;height:152px;border-radius:12px}.ColdQuestLoader_action__IJJ2e{display:flex;flex-direction:row;align-items:center;gap:8px;margin:8px 16px 0;padding:6px;border-radius:100px;background:var(--background-base);box-shadow:0 10px 40px 0 rgba(0,0,0,.2)}.ColdQuestLoader_progressText__8qYQ_{width:140px;height:12px;margin-left:22px;border-radius:6px}.ColdQuestLoader_button__FWEmp{flex-shrink:0;width:120px;height:40px;border-radius:999px}.ColdQuestStepGenres_container__OCxso{display:flex;flex-direction:column;height:100%;width:100%}.ColdQuestStepGenres_main__ody4Z{flex:1 1;min-height:0;overflow:hidden}.ColdQuestGenreTag_tag__HB4LZ{height:100%;flex-shrink:0;border-radius:20px;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:6px;padding:0 16px 0 12px;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none;-webkit-tap-highlight-color:transparent;box-shadow:0 0 24px 0 var(--actions-button-bg) inset;background:radial-gradient(60.48% 60.48% at 50% 50%,var(--actions-button-bg) 0,var(--actions-button-bg) 100%);transition:transform .2s ease,background .2s ease,box-shadow .2s ease;outline:none;touch-action:manipulation}.ColdQuestGenreTag_tagSelected__1AoiC{transform:scale(.96);box-shadow:inset 0 0 24px 0 #ff3d3d;background:radial-gradient(60.48% 60.48% at 50% 50%,#ffe1c5 0,#ffc885 100%)}.ColdQuestGenreTag_tagIcon___YAJb{width:82px;height:82px;flex-shrink:0;-o-object-fit:contain;object-fit:contain}.ColdQuestGenreTag_tagLabel__raYhT{color:var(--actions-primary);text-align:center}[data-theme=dark] .ColdQuestGenreTag_tagLabel__raYhT{color:var(--text-primary)}.ColdQuestGenreTag_tagSelected__1AoiC .ColdQuestGenreTag_tagLabel__raYhT{color:var(--common-black100)}.ColdQuestGenres_container___9_UL{padding:8px 16px;display:grid;grid-gap:10px;gap:10px;height:100%;grid-template-rows:repeat(auto-fill,162px);grid-auto-flow:column;grid-auto-columns:162px;place-content:center flex-start;overflow-x:auto;overflow-y:hidden;-webkit-overflow-scrolling:touch;scrollbar-width:none}.ColdQuestAction_root__QjdCX{display:flex;flex-direction:row;background:var(--actions-button-elements);box-shadow:0 10px 40px 0 rgba(0,0,0,.2);padding:6px;margin:8px 16px 0;border-radius:100px;gap:8px;align-items:center}.ColdQuestAction_progress__ywqld{padding-left:22px;flex-grow:1}.ColdQuestAction_progressText__wFCE5.ColdQuestAction_progressText__wFCE5{display:flex;color:var(--text-secondary)}[data-theme=dark] .ColdQuestAction_progressText__wFCE5.ColdQuestAction_progressText__wFCE5{color:var(--text-on-contrast)}.ColdQuestAction_progressBar__eAgMh{margin-top:4px;width:78px}